You completely missed key points. They are covered in much more depth in the 1984 "Greystoke" which details Tarzan's journey back to civilization, learning things, including reading and writing, plus social customs. Tarzan, John Clayton, is depicted with high intellect and a quick learner. Over some period of time he transitioned from a wild man to an English gentleman.

This movie starts a few years after that, when John Clayton is firmly entrenched in his role as earl of Greystoke, he and Jane are part of the British aristocracy.
